※参考情報 エチレン n-ブチルアクリレートコポリマー(EnBA)は、エチレンとn-ブチルアクリレートの共重合体であり、特に柔軟性と耐衝撃性に優れた特性を持つポリマーです。EnBAは、エチレンの剛直な骨格とアクリル系モノマーの柔軟性を組み合わせた構造により、様々な用途に利用されています。 EnBAの特性としては、まずその柔軟性が挙げられます。エチレン部分は高い機械的強度と耐久性を提供し、n-ブチルアクリレート部分は優れた伸縮性をもたらします。このため、EnBAは高弾性と優れた変形能力を兼ね備えています。また、EnBAは耐候性や耐化学薬品性にも優れており、外部環境に対して安定した性能を発揮します。これらの特性から、EnBAは多くの産業分野で利用される材料となっています。 EnBAの種類には、主にその分子量やポリマーの組成によるバリエーションがあります。一般的には、高分子量のタイプが高い機械的強度を持ち、低分子量のタイプは柔軟性に富んでいるとされています。また、特定の用途に応じて、添加剤や改質剤を加えることにより、性能を調整することも可能です。これにより、非粘着性や粘着性、さらには透明性を持つ製品が得られます。 EnBAの用途は広範囲にわたります。まず、接着剤やコーティング剤としての利用が挙げられます。EnBAは優れた接着性能を持ち、多様な基材に対して強力な接着性を示すため、建築材料や自動車部品などに利用されます。また、エラストマーとしての特性を活かし、靴底やスポーツ用品、ゴム製品にも使用されています。さらに、包装材料としても採用されており、特に食品包装や医療用包装材において、その安全性と耐久性が評価されています。 関係技術については、EnBAの製造には主にラジカル重合と呼ばれるプロセスが利用されています。この方法では、エチレンとn-ブチルアクリレートを高温・高圧で重合し、EnBAを合成します。また、必要に応じて、触媒や添加剤を用いて反応条件を最適化し、所望の特性を持つポリマーを得ることができます。さらに、EnBAの応用分野での特性向上にも関連技術が重要です。例えば、ナノコンポジット技術を用いて、ナノ粒子を添加することで、強度や熱安定性を向上させることが可能です。 全体として、エチレン n-ブチルアクリレートコポリマー(EnBA)は、柔軟性、強度、耐薬品性を兼ね備えた重要な材料であり、その特性を生かした様々な用途での利用が期待されています。今後も、技術革新とともに新たな応用が開拓されることで、さらなる成長が見込まれる材料です。 |
